And here are some key features: +- LayoutParser provides a rich repository of deep learning models for layout detection as well as a set of unified APIs for using them. For example, +
+ Perform DL layout detection in 4 lines of code + ```python + import layoutparser as lp + model = lp.AutoLayoutModel('lp://EfficientDete/PubLayNet') + # image = Image.open("path/to/image") + layout = model.detect(image) + ``` +
+- LayoutParser comes with a set of layout data structures with carefully designed APIs that are optimized for document image analysis tasks. For example, +
+ Selecting layout/textual elements in the left column of a page + ```python + image_width = image.size[0] + left_column = lp.Interval(0, image_width/2, axis='x') + layout.filter_by(left_column, center=True) # select objects in the left column + ``` +
+
+ Performing OCR for each detected Layout Region + ```python + ocr_agent = lp.TesseractAgent() + for layout_region in layout: + image_segment = layout_region.crop(image) + text = ocr_agent.detect(image_segment) + ``` +
+
+ Flexible APIs for visualizing the detected layouts + ```python + lp.draw_box(image, layout, box_width=1, show_element_id=True, box_alpha=0.25) + ``` +
+ +
+ Loading layout data stored in json, csv, and even PDFs + ```python + layout = lp.load_json("path/to/json") + layout = lp.load_csv("path/to/csv") + pdf_layout = lp.load_pdf("path/to/pdf") + ``` +

+## Installation +After several major updates, layoutparser provides various functionalities and deep learning models from different backends. But it still easy to install layoutparser, and we designed the installation method in a way such that you can choose to install only the needed dependencies for your project: +```bash +pip install layoutparser # Install the base layoutparser library with +pip install "layoutparser[layoutmodels]" # Install DL layout model toolkit +pip install "layoutparser[ocr]" # Install OCR toolkit +``` +Extra steps are needed if you want to use Detectron2-based models.
